    Remote Admin via Bluetooth for phone

    Hi peeps.

    My brother came down to visit me for the weekend and on his phone he could control my computer via bluetooth.. he said he got the software with the phone, so I was wondering if there is any software I can download for my phone so I can control my computer using my phone via bluetooth? My phone supports Java, it's a T610.

    You can use it. I have used it to control mouse, winamp, media player etc...

    Use joystick on T68i as mouse

    Does loads of cool stuff...

    You can also use bluetooth to share your broadband internet connection...saves on the GPRS bill
